Simple CPR assistant that signals recommended pace of heart compression.

Application that may assist with CPR by showing the pace of the heart compression and rescue breathing. Main features: - one click to start the assistant - heart pulses demonstrate the recommended chest compression frequency - a beep sound indicates when the chest compression should be performed - chest compression counter restarts to suggest the rescue breath - shows elapsed time from the start of CPR - call an ambulance button - after confirmation initiates a call to the ambulance (on the speaker phone) Configuration: - pulse frequency and chest compression counter restarts can be configured to allow for CPR for adults/children - the default configuration applies for adults: 100 pulses per minute, rescue breath every 30 pulses - ambulance phone number - 112 by default but can be easily changed to country specific number e.g. 911 Please comment and/or rate.
